| Type | Name | Description |
|---|---|---|
| BIOLOGICAL | self ligating bracket with micro osteoperforation | A standardized wire sequence of .012'', 0.014'',0,016'', and 0.016''×0.022'' nickel-titanium were followed to achieve leveling and alignment. Micro-osteoperforations will be formed |
| BIOLOGICAL | conventional bracket with micro osteoperforation | A standardized wire sequence of .012'', 0.014'',0,016'', and 0.016''×0.022'' nickel-titanium were followed to achieve leveling and alignment. Micro-osteoperforations will be formed. |
| BIOLOGICAL | conventional bracket without micro osteoperforation | A standardized wire sequence of .012'', 0.014'',0,016'', and 0.016''×0.022'' nickel titanium were followed to achieve leveling and alignment |
| BIOLOGICAL | self ligating bracket without micro osteoperforation | A standardized wire sequence of .012'', 0.014'',0,016'', and 0.016''×0.022'' nickel-titanium were followed to achieve leveling and alignment. |
